Growing up in Bergenfield, my freinds and I would make the weekly commute to Island in '61 and '62 out rt46(before I80 was completed). We'd have breakfast at the Hacketstown Diner spend the day in the pits and always return with white shoe polish on the windshield and left rear window indicating the class. I ran a C/G (gas) and then a B/A (altered), both street legal. We graduated in '62 and went then separate ways.
